дата: 14.03.2024 14:50

Что такое try-catch и как его использовать

В программировании, особенно при работе с кодом, который может вызвать ошибки или сбои, важно иметь возможность обрабатывать эти ситуации. Одним из способов сделать это является использование конструкций try-catch.

Конструкция try-catch позволяет определить блок кода, который может вызвать ошибку, и обработать эту ошибку внутри блока. Если ошибка возникает, то она будет перехвачена и обработана внутри блока try-catch. Это позволяет избежать аварийного завершения программы и сохранить ее работоспособность.

Вот пример использования конструкции try-catch:

try {
    // код, который может вызвать ошибку
} catch (Exception e) {
    // обработка ошибки
    System.out.println("Ошибка произошла: " + e);
}

В данном примере, если в блоке try произойдет ошибка, то она будет перехвачена и обработана внутри блока catch. В блоке catch можно выполнить действия по обработке ошибки, например, вывести сообщение об ошибке.

Важно отметить, что конструкция try-catch не только помогает обрабатывать ошибки, но и делает код более читаемым и понятным для других разработчиков. Она также может помочь улучшить производительность программы, так как позволяет избежать аварийного завершения программы и потери данных.